Why Leander Homes Require Professional Roofing

Protecting your home from the volatile Central Texas weather.

Leander homes are subjected to a challenging climate featuring scorching summer heat, intense UV rays, and sudden, severe spring thunderstorms that can bring hail and high winds. Your roof is the primary defense against these elements. Over time, materials degrade, leading to potential leaks and structural damage. Utilizing professional roofing contractors near you ensures your roof is assessed for proper ventilation and material integrity. Modern roof replacement services use advanced materials that provide superior heat reflection and impact resistance, which are crucial for managing our area's extreme temperature shifts and protecting the structural lifespan of your home.

Is It Time for a Roof Replacement in Leander?

Identify the critical warning signs before serious damage occurs.

check

Missing, cracked, or curling shingles after severe weather events

check

Granule loss visible in gutters or at the base of downspouts

check

Dark stains or streaking on the roof surface indicating algae growth

check

Visible sagging or depression in the roof line

check

Water leaks in the attic or ceilings after rainfall

Local Requirements & Rebates

Navigating permits and standards in Leander.

  • Climate Zone: Central Texas requires roofing materials capable of handling high thermal expansion and contraction cycles.
  • Permits: Almost all full roof replacements in Leander require a residential building permit. Ensure your chosen local roofing companies handle the permit application with the City of Leander.
  • Rebates: While direct roof rebates are rare, some insurance companies offer discounts for installing impact-resistant or Class 4 rated roofing materials.

Leander Roof Cost Guide

Plan your roofing budget with confidence.

  • Basic: $7,000–$12,000, featuring standard 3-tab asphalt shingles; a cost-effective solution for straightforward roof replacements.
  • Mid-Range: $12,000–$20,000, including high-quality architectural shingles that provide better wind resistance and the average cost of new roofs in the area.
  • Premium: $20,000+, covering metal roofing or high-performance synthetic materials that offer maximum longevity and superior energy efficiency.

5 Questions to Ask Before Hiring a Leander Contractor

Ensure your project is protected by working with a qualified local professional.

  • Are you fully licensed and carrying both general liability and workers' compensation insurance?
  • Can you provide your Texas Residential Contractor registration details for the project?
  • What specific experience do you have with the high-wind and hail events common in the Leander area?
  • Do you provide a written warranty that covers both the roofing materials and the quality of your installation labor?
  • Can you provide references from recent roof replacement projects in Leander or Williamson County?

Roofing Material Recommendations

Recommended options for the Leander climate.

  • Architectural Asphalt Shingles: The most common choice in Leander; they offer excellent wind resistance and come in a variety of styles that complement local architecture.
  • Metal Roofing: Gaining popularity for its exceptional durability against hail and extreme heat, often lasting 40+ years in Central Texas.
  • Cool Roof Technology: Shingles designed to reflect more sunlight, which is ideal for reducing cooling loads during Leander’s long, hot summers.
